Penetration Testing Services
Cybersecurity has become one of the biggest concerns for businesses in the United States. Every day, companies store customer information, financial records, employee data, and other valuable digital assets. While technology helps businesses grow, it also creates opportunities for cybercriminals to search for weaknesses.
Many organizations invest in security software, firewalls, and monitoring tools. However, even strong security systems can have hidden gaps. This is where penetration testing services play an important role.
Penetration testing helps businesses discover security weaknesses before cybercriminals can take advantage of them. Instead of waiting for a real attack, companies hire security professionals to safely test their systems and identify vulnerabilities.
In this guide, you will learn what penetration testing services are, why they matter, how they work, and how businesses can choose the right provider.
What Are Penetration Testing Services?
Penetration testing services are cybersecurity assessments designed to evaluate the security of systems, networks, applications, and physical locations.
During a penetration test, security professionals attempt to identify and safely exploit weaknesses in a controlled environment. The goal is not to cause damage but to uncover security issues that need attention.
You can think of penetration testing as a security checkup for your business.
Just as a doctor identifies health concerns before they become serious problems, penetration testers identify security risks before attackers can use them.
Why Businesses Need Penetration Testing
Cyber threats continue to grow every year.
Small businesses, large corporations, healthcare organizations, financial institutions, and government agencies all face security risks.
A successful cyberattack can lead to:
- Data breaches
- Financial losses
- Business disruption
- Reputation damage
- Legal issues
- Customer trust problems
Penetration testing services help organizations find security gaps early and strengthen their defenses.
How Penetration Testing Works
A penetration test follows a structured process.
Security professionals typically perform several stages during the assessment.
Planning and Scoping
The testing team works with the client to define goals and determine which systems will be tested.
Information Gathering
Testers collect information about the target environment.
This may include:
- Websites
- Networks
- Servers
- Applications
- Security controls
Vulnerability Analysis
The team identifies possible weaknesses that could be exploited.
Controlled Testing
Security professionals attempt to safely demonstrate how vulnerabilities could be used by attackers.
Reporting
After testing, the organization receives a detailed report outlining findings and recommendations.
Benefits of Penetration Testing Services
Businesses gain several important benefits from regular testing.
Identify Hidden Weaknesses
Many vulnerabilities remain unnoticed until they are discovered during testing.
Improve Security
Organizations can fix weaknesses before attackers find them.
Meet Compliance Requirements
Certain industries require security assessments to meet regulations and standards.
Protect Customer Trust
Strong security helps maintain confidence among customers and partners.
Reduce Financial Risk
Preventing a cyberattack is often much less expensive than recovering from one.
Types of Penetration Testing Services
Different businesses have different security needs.
Several types of testing may be used depending on the environment being evaluated.
| Testing Type | Purpose |
|---|---|
| Network Testing | Evaluates network security |
| Web Application Testing | Reviews website and application security |
| Wireless Testing | Examines wireless networks |
| Cloud Security Testing | Reviews cloud environments |
| Physical Security Testing | Assesses physical access controls |
| Social Engineering Testing | Evaluates employee awareness |
Each type focuses on a specific area of security.
Understanding Network Penetration Testing Services
Network penetration testing services focus on evaluating the security of business networks.
Most organizations rely heavily on networks to connect devices, employees, servers, and applications.
If a network contains weaknesses, attackers may gain unauthorized access.
What Network Testing Examines
Network penetration testing services often review:
- Firewalls
- Routers
- Switches
- Internal networks
- External networks
- Remote access systems
- VPN connections
The goal is to determine whether attackers could gain access to sensitive information.
Why Network Testing Matters
Modern businesses depend on network connectivity.
A compromised network can lead to:
- Data theft
- Service outages
- Malware infections
- Unauthorized access
Regular network assessments help reduce these risks.
Physical Penetration Testing Services
Cybersecurity is not only about computers and software.
Physical security also plays an important role.
Physical penetration testing services evaluate whether someone could gain unauthorized access to facilities, offices, or restricted areas.
Examples of Physical Security Testing
Physical testing may include attempts to:
- Access restricted areas
- Bypass security controls
- Enter buildings without authorization
- Test visitor management procedures
These assessments help organizations identify weaknesses in their physical security programs.
Why Physical Security Matters
Even the best cybersecurity system can be compromised if an attacker gains physical access to critical equipment.
Physical penetration testing services help organizations improve both digital and physical security.
Common Vulnerabilities Found During Testing
Security assessments often uncover issues that organizations may not realize exist.
Some common findings include:
| Vulnerability | Risk |
| Weak Passwords | Unauthorized access |
| Outdated Software | Security exploits |
| Misconfigured Systems | Increased attack exposure |
| Poor Access Controls | Data breaches |
| Unsecured Services | External attacks |
Addressing these issues helps strengthen overall security.
Who Should Use Penetration Testing Services?

Many organizations benefit from regular security assessments.
Examples include:
- Small businesses
- Large corporations
- Healthcare providers
- Financial institutions
- E-commerce companies
- Educational organizations
- Government agencies
Any organization that stores sensitive information should consider testing.
Also Read – Penetration Testing Services: Strengthen Your Business Cybersecurity
Penetration Testing Companies and Their Role
Penetration testing companies specialize in evaluating security and identifying vulnerabilities.
These companies employ experienced security professionals who understand how attackers operate.
Their goal is to help organizations improve security before a real incident occurs.
What to Look for in Penetration Testing Companies
When evaluating penetration testing companies, consider:
- Industry experience
- Security certifications
- Testing methodology
- Reporting quality
- Client references
- Communication skills
A trusted provider should clearly explain findings and recommendations.
How Often Should Testing Be Performed?
The answer depends on several factors.
Organizations should consider testing:
- After major system changes
- Before launching new applications
- Following infrastructure upgrades
- Annually as part of routine security reviews
Some industries require more frequent testing due to regulatory requirements.
Internal vs External Penetration Testing
Businesses often hear these terms when discussing security assessments.
Internal Testing
Internal testing evaluates risks from inside the organization.
This may simulate:
- Insider threats
- Compromised employee accounts
- Internal network attacks
External Testing
External testing focuses on systems accessible from the internet.
This helps identify weaknesses visible to outside attackers.
Both approaches provide valuable insights.
Penetration Testing and Compliance
Many industries have security standards and regulations.
Regular testing may support compliance efforts.
Examples include:
- Healthcare regulations
- Financial industry requirements
- Data protection standards
- Security frameworks
Testing demonstrates a commitment to protecting sensitive information.
Common Misunderstandings About Penetration Testing
Several myths continue to exist.
Myth 1: Only Large Companies Need Testing
Cybercriminals target organizations of all sizes.
Small businesses are often attractive targets because they may have fewer security resources.
Myth 2: Antivirus Software Is Enough
Security software is important, but it cannot identify every vulnerability.
Testing provides a deeper evaluation.
Myth 3: Testing Causes Damage
Professional penetration testing follows controlled procedures designed to minimize risk.
Myth 4: One Test Is Enough
Security changes over time.
Regular testing helps maintain protection.
Factors That Affect Penetration Testing Costs
Several elements influence pricing.
| Factor | Impact |
| Network Size | Larger environments require more work |
| Application Complexity | More complex systems take longer |
| Testing Scope | Broader assessments increase costs |
| Number of Locations | Multiple locations require additional effort |
| Security Requirements | Specialized testing may increase costs |
Organizations should focus on quality and expertise rather than choosing solely based on price.
Building a Strong Security Strategy
Penetration testing works best as part of a larger cybersecurity program.
Businesses should also consider:
- Employee security training
- Regular software updates
- Multi-factor authentication
- Data backups
- Security monitoring
- Access control reviews
Combining these measures creates stronger protection against cyber threats.
Why Experience Matters
Experienced security professionals understand how attackers think and operate.
They can often identify weaknesses that automated tools may miss.
This is one reason why organizations often partner with reputable penetration testing companies that have proven experience and industry knowledge.
Expert analysis helps businesses make informed security decisions.
Frequently Asked Questions
What are penetration testing services?
Penetration testing services are security assessments designed to identify vulnerabilities in systems, networks, applications, and physical environments.
Why are penetration testing services important?
They help organizations find and fix security weaknesses before attackers can exploit them.
What are network penetration testing services?
Network penetration testing services evaluate the security of internal and external networks to identify potential vulnerabilities.
What are physical penetration testing services?
Physical penetration testing services assess physical security controls such as building access, visitor procedures, and restricted areas.
How often should penetration testing be performed?
Many organizations perform testing annually, after major system changes, or before launching new applications.
Are penetration testing companies safe to hire?
Reputable penetration testing companies follow professional methodologies and conduct testing in a controlled manner.
Can small businesses benefit from penetration testing?
Yes. Small businesses often store valuable data and can benefit from identifying security risks early.
Does penetration testing guarantee complete security?
No security measure can guarantee complete protection, but testing helps significantly reduce risk by identifying vulnerabilities.
Conclusion
Penetration testing services have become an important part of modern cybersecurity. Businesses of all sizes face growing threats from cybercriminals, making proactive security assessments more valuable than ever. Rather than waiting for a real attack, organizations can use testing to uncover weaknesses and strengthen defenses.
Network penetration testing services help secure critical systems and communications, while physical penetration testing services evaluate building security and access controls. Together, these assessments provide a broader view of an organization’s overall security posture.
Choosing experienced penetration testing companies can help businesses gain valuable insights, improve protection, and build trust with customers, employees, and partners. By making penetration testing part of a regular security strategy, organizations can better prepare for today’s evolving cybersecurity challenges and reduce the risk of costly incidents in the future.